Ingredients
Scale
- 4 boneless, skinless chicken breasts (about 1 lb)
- 2 cloves fresh garlic, minced
- 4 oz ramen noodles (fresh or dried)
- 4 cups chicken broth
- 2 tbsp Sriracha sauce (adjust to taste)
- 1 cup mixed vegetables (bok choy and green onions)
- 3 tbsp low-sodium soy sauce
- 1 tbsp sesame oil
Instructions
- Slice the chicken breasts into thin strips and season with salt and pepper.
- Heat oil in a skillet over medium-high heat, add chicken strips, and sauté until golden brown (5-7 minutes). Remove and set aside.
- In the same skillet, sauté minced garlic until fragrant. Add chicken broth and bring to a simmer. Stir in Sriracha sauce.
- Cook ramen noodles according to package instructions; drain and set aside.
- Add cooked noodles back to the broth along with chicken and vegetables; simmer for an additional 3 minutes.
- Serve hot, garnished with green onions or sesame seeds.
